Block 643,417

00000000000000000009a4b4373800d6c28aaf73677850c43e5f28719817975e
288,999 confirmations
Timestamp
1597266202
Tx count3,023
Traces0
Avg fee54,039 sats
view on mempool.space

Transactions

No transactions found.

Showing 0 / 0